**Vendor note: Inkmill markdown pipeline**

Rendering for Parchway docs is outsourced to Inkmill under an annual contract, renewing each March. They handle sanitization and PDF export; we own the upload queue. SLA: 4-hour response on rendering failures. Escalate only after two failed retries. Their support desk is reachable at the address below.

billing contact of hahaf-baguf = zorael.tammir.jorius@sivrelhq.internal

## Action Item: Harden Brambleway cleanup bot

Following the incident where the Brambleway bot deleted a release branch, we are adding protected-pattern checks and a mandatory dry-run window before any destructive action. Deletions now require two consecutive passes flagging the same branch. Please review the thresholds for abuse potential, since a compromised config could accelerate deletions. The proposed limits are as follows.

tuning table, faduf-baduf:
PRIORITIES = {
    "ulavan": 191,
    "silys": 750,
    "goriel": 238,
    "kelmir": 66,
    "wendor": 432,
}

Subject: Handover — SplitCourier assignment service

For security review. SplitCourier assigns A/B buckets for all Venner-platform experiments. Release 2.9 pending. Changes: bucket hashing moved server-side, sticky assignments persisted, admin override path removed. Audit logs now immutable. No open CVEs; one low-severity dependency bump queued. Rollback plan documented in the runbook. Artifacts are signed per policy; verify each one against the key below.

signing key of fajop-tahop = bky9_qdL6xeDv7